ADMISSIONS TO FIRST YEAR FULL TIME POST SSC AND POST HSC DIPLOMA COURSES IN
ENGINEERING/TECHNOLOGY, PHARMACY AND HMCT FOR THE ACADEMIC YEAR 2011-12


Availability of Information brochure and Application Kit and other details
 Information Brochure and Application Kit will be available for sale at the cost of Rs. 400/- for
General Category candidates (Rs 300/- for reserved category candidates belonging to
Maharashtra State only) in Cash at all Application form Receipt Centres (ARCs) listed below. No
other mode of payment shall be permitted. This fee is non-refundable and non-transferable
under any circumstances.
 It is mandatory for the aspiring candidates to procure the Information Brochure and Application
Kit from ARC. The Application Kit consists of Application ID and Password, by which the
candidate shall be able to fill the Online Application Form.

 Submission and Confirmation of online filled application form:-
 All Candidates are required to fill the web based online application form on
http://www.dte.org.in/poly2011 at ARC/ Cyber Cafe or any computer connected to internet and
take printout of the “Online filled Application Form”.
 The candidate should sign on the printout of online filled Application Form and attach the
required attested copies of documents.

 All Maharashtra State candidates should report in person to the ARC for confirmation along with
attested true copies and original documents for verification. Applications submitted online and
subsequently confirmed at ARCs will only be considered valid for further processing.
 Candidates claiming admission against seats for N.C.C. shall submit their applications to “The
Director of N.C.C.” Maharashtra State, A.F.I. Building, Bombay Hospital Lane, Near Metro
Cinema, Mumbai - 400 020.
 Candidates claiming admission against seats under centrally sponsored scheme of Ministry of
Human Resource Development of GoI for persons with disabilities shall apply directly to the
Principal in response to the notification of the concerned Institute as mentioned in the
information brochure.
 Other than Maharashtra candidates (OMS) are not eligible for admission through CAP, such
candidates shall contact to unaided institutes for admission to institute level seats.
 The candidates are advised to report to the same ARC from where the form is purchased for
various activities.
 ARCs shall also provide facility to fill online application to the candidates free of cost and also
provide required support for browsing of information such as merit list, allotment status etc.
